About the Role
In this role, you will work in an energized, fast paced environment where you will work with peers to prepare and move merchandise according to established safety, production, and accuracy standards and employment guidelines. You will be Customer Curious as you maintain and verify documentation to facilitate the flow of merchandise through the Distribution Center to deliver outstanding product to our customers.What You'll Do

About the company
Gap Inc. is the largest specialty retailer in the United States, and is 3rd in total international locations, behind Inditex Group and H&M. As of September 2008, the company has approximately 135,000 employees and operates 3,727 stores worldwide, of which 2,406 are located in the U.S.
